Papaya Cream

Image
This is an excellent dessert, well known in the Brazilian culture. Really easy to make, all you do is blend 3 ingredients in the blender. Normally every time that I've had this dessert, it was with something called 'creme de cassis' but this is often hard to find. I found an excellent substitution that when lightly drizzled on top tastes the exact same. Delicious. This dessert can be quite expensive. Fogo De chao Brazilian restaurant here in New York sales it for a whopping $11.50... But this dessert can be made at home for about $3 max. Look at how easy and delicious. Papaya Cream Servings: 4 Servings Prep Time: 2 minutes Total time: 5 Minutes Ingredients 1 Medium Papaya 2 cups vanilla ice cream 1/2 tsp honey Peel and cut your papaya in large cubes ( removing all black seeds).
